The audiological devices market faces a range of challenges that can hinder its growth and accessibility. Understanding these obstacles is crucial for stakeholders aiming to enhance the quality of hearing solutions available to consumers.

One of the primary challenges is the stigma associated with hearing loss and the use of hearing aids. Many individuals feel self-conscious about wearing hearing devices, often viewing them as a sign of aging or weakness. This stigma can discourage people from seeking necessary assistance, leading to untreated hearing loss and associated health issues. Overcoming this perception requires concerted efforts in awareness campaigns that promote the benefits of addressing hearing challenges.

Regulatory complexities also pose significant hurdles for the audiological devices market. Different regions have varying regulations regarding the approval and distribution of hearing aids and other audiological devices. Navigating these regulatory frameworks can be time-consuming and costly for manufacturers, particularly smaller companies that may lack the resources to comply with diverse requirements. These complexities can limit market entry for innovative solutions, affecting consumer access to advanced hearing technology.

Moreover, the rapid pace of technological advancement presents both opportunities and challenges. While innovation is essential for keeping up with consumer demands, it also requires manufacturers to invest heavily in research and development. The need to continually update product offerings can strain resources and lead to increased competition. Additionally, as devices become more technologically complex, some users, particularly older adults, may find it challenging to adapt to new functionalities.

Another challenge is the rising cost of advanced audiological devices. Despite efforts to promote affordability and accessibility, high prices can still be a barrier for many individuals seeking hearing solutions. This financial strain can discourage people from pursuing treatment, particularly those without adequate insurance coverage.

In short, the audiological devices market faces several challenges, including stigma, regulatory complexities, rapid technological advancements, and cost barriers. Addressing these issues is vital for fostering an environment that encourages individuals to seek the hearing care they need. By implementing effective strategies to overcome these challenges, stakeholders can work towards a more inclusive and accessible audiological devices market.
